Before I explain how the course will run, let me clear up a few common misconceptions. This course is identical in content to the classroom_____. It is not a watered down version, nor significantly more difficult in content than the classroom experience. The difference is the method of delivery. In a traditional classroom setting you would spend about three hours a week in class and another six hours doing homework, studying, working on assignments and so on. Here, you will spend about the same amount of time every week, just in a different setting. Asynchronous is not self-paced. You have a schedule with deadlines to meet. Whether you work early in the morning, during the day while the children are at school or late at night you will be doing the same assignment as everyone else in the class. You must budget your time for this just as you plan time for your traditional classes and other activities.
